public class PricePlanAdjustmentProcessRunDefinition extends ProcessRunDefinition
Constructor and Description |
---|
PricePlanAdjustmentProcessRunDefinition() |
Modifier and Type | Method and Description |
---|---|
com.crm.dataobject.pricing.PricePlanAdjustmentConditionType |
getAdjustmentConditionType() |
java.lang.String |
getAffectedProductsLabel() |
java.util.Date |
getAsOfDate() |
java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> |
getExcludedProducts() |
java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> |
getIncludedProducts() |
java.lang.String |
getNotAffectedProductsLabel() |
java.math.BigDecimal |
getPercentage() |
java.util.ArrayList<com.crm.dataobject.priceplan.CRMDOPricePlan> |
getPricePlans() |
java.lang.String |
getPricePlansLabel() |
SchedulerTask |
getSchedulerTask() |
java.util.Date |
getVatRateChangeAsOfDate() |
java.util.Set<com.crm.dataobject.platform.CRMDOVatRate> |
getVatRates() |
java.util.LinkedHashMap<java.lang.String,java.lang.String> |
getViewMandatoryFields() |
void |
setAdjustmentConditionType(com.crm.dataobject.pricing.PricePlanAdjustmentConditionType adjustmentConditionType) |
void |
setAffectedProductsLabel(java.lang.String affectedProductsLabel) |
void |
setAsOfDate(java.util.Date asOfDate) |
void |
setExcludedProducts(java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> excludedProducts) |
void |
setIncludedProducts(java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> includedProducts) |
void |
setNotAffectedProductsLabel(java.lang.String notAffectedProductsLabel) |
void |
setPercentage(java.math.BigDecimal percentage) |
void |
setPricePlans(java.util.ArrayList<com.crm.dataobject.priceplan.CRMDOPricePlan> pricePlans) |
void |
setPricePlansLabel(java.lang.String pricePlansLabel) |
void |
setSchedulerTask(SchedulerTask schedulerTask) |
void |
setVatRateChangeAsOfDate(java.util.Date vatRateChangeAsOfDate) |
void |
setVatRates(java.util.Set<com.crm.dataobject.platform.CRMDOVatRate> vatRates) |
getProcessRunDefinition, getRunsRepeatedly, getScheduledDate, getSchedulingInformation, setProcessRunDefinition, setRunsRepeatedly, setScheduledDate, setSchedulingInformation
clone, compareObjects, compareTo, deepCopy, equals, getAlias, getAliases, getAltCode, getAttachments, getCode, getComparableByXPath, getCreatedByUnit, getCreatedByUser, getCreatedDate, getDefaultMandatoryFields, getDeletedFlagFieldName, getDescription, getFieldsize, getFieldsizes, getId, getIsAssignable, getIsDeletable, getIsDeleted, getIsEditable, getIsRestricted, getIsViewable, getMandatoryFields, getModifiedCollections, getName, getNewvalues, getNotes, getNotVisibleActions, getNotVisibleFields, getNotVisiblePrintouts, getNumber, getOldvalues, getOwnerCollection, getProperties, getProperty, getReadOnlyFields, getRecVersion, getSharedNotes, getSortby, getUpdatedByUnit, getUpdatedByUser, getUpdatedDate, initFieldsizes, initializeCRMDO, isAssignable, isDeletable, isDeleted, isEditable, isMandatory, isModified, isModified, isNew, isRestricted, isSortbyDefined, isSpecified, isViewable, networkRestrictionsSet, onDelete, onLoad, onLoad, onSave, onSave, onUpdate, securityRestrictionsSet, setAlias, setAltCode, setAttachments, setChange, setCode, setCreatedByUnit, setCreatedByUser, setCreatedDate, setDefaultMandatoryFields, setDescription, setFieldsize, setId, setIsAssignable, setIsDeletable, setIsDeleted, setIsEditable, setIsRestricted, setIsViewable, setMandatoryFields, setModified, setModifiedCollections, setName, setNetworkRestrictionsSet, setNew, setNew, setNewvalues, setNotes, setNotVisibleActions, setNotVisibleFields, setNotVisiblePrintouts, setNumber, setOldvalues, setOwnerCollection, setProperty, setReadOnlyFields, setRecVersion, setSecurityRestrictionsSet, setSharedNotes, setSortby, setUpdatedByUnit, setUpdatedByUser, setUpdatedDate, sortbyCompareTo, toString
public PricePlanAdjustmentProcessRunDefinition()
public java.util.Date getVatRateChangeAsOfDate()
public void setVatRateChangeAsOfDate(java.util.Date vatRateChangeAsOfDate)
public java.util.Set<com.crm.dataobject.platform.CRMDOVatRate> getVatRates()
public void setVatRates(java.util.Set<com.crm.dataobject.platform.CRMDOVatRate> vatRates)
public java.util.ArrayList<com.crm.dataobject.priceplan.CRMDOPricePlan> getPricePlans()
public void setPricePlans(java.util.ArrayList<com.crm.dataobject.priceplan.CRMDOPricePlan> pricePlans)
public java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> getIncludedProducts()
public void setIncludedProducts(java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> includedProducts)
public java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> getExcludedProducts()
public void setExcludedProducts(java.util.ArrayList<com.crm.dataobject.products.CRMDOProduct> excludedProducts)
public SchedulerTask getSchedulerTask()
getSchedulerTask
in class ProcessRunDefinition
public void setSchedulerTask(SchedulerTask schedulerTask)
setSchedulerTask
in class ProcessRunDefinition
public java.util.LinkedHashMap<java.lang.String,java.lang.String> getViewMandatoryFields()
getViewMandatoryFields
in class ProcessRunDefinition
public java.util.Date getAsOfDate()
public void setAsOfDate(java.util.Date asOfDate)
public java.math.BigDecimal getPercentage()
public void setPercentage(java.math.BigDecimal percentage)
public com.crm.dataobject.pricing.PricePlanAdjustmentConditionType getAdjustmentConditionType()
public void setAdjustmentConditionType(com.crm.dataobject.pricing.PricePlanAdjustmentConditionType adjustmentConditionType)
public java.lang.String getPricePlansLabel()
public void setPricePlansLabel(java.lang.String pricePlansLabel)
public java.lang.String getNotAffectedProductsLabel()
public void setNotAffectedProductsLabel(java.lang.String notAffectedProductsLabel)
public java.lang.String getAffectedProductsLabel()
public void setAffectedProductsLabel(java.lang.String affectedProductsLabel)